NOAA 1589 is mostly unchanged maintaining its D-type
sunspot group with weak polarity mixing.  It was the source
of a few C-class events in the past 24 hours.  The largest
was a C9.0 at 10/12/8:20 UT. C-class activity probable with
an isolated M-class event possible in the next 24 hour period.

The position of NOAA1589 on October 12 at 13:00 UT is:
N12E41 (Solar X = -618", Solar Y = 124")
